As our Roadside Recovery Driver, you’ll go the extra mile for our customers. Anything can happen whilst driving, but it’s OK we are the AA! We get everyone back on the road safely and get their day moving again.
On Target Earnings: £41,000 for a CE licence, and £35,000 for a C licence. Salary: Guaranteed minimum c. £33,862 for CE (HGV 1) license, £30,490 for C (HGV 2) license.
Depot Postcode: GL2 5DA. Shifts: Rolling Rosta, working 18 out of 28 days with 2 weekends off. Standard Shifts are 9 hours 45 mins (Inc. 45 min break). End of shift flexibility is required meaning you may work up to 12 hours in a shift inc. break.

This is the job: You’ll be the friendly face of the UK’s largest motoring organisation. To our customers, you’re the superhero. Ready for anything, you’ll be there for them, anytime, anywhere and in any weather. You’ll get their day moving again by using your technical skills to load vehicles onto your truck and getting the vehicle and customer to a garage for repair, or wherever they need to be.

What do I need? To be eligible for this role you must live within 25 miles OR 1 hour's travel from the depot – postcode included in advert. A full driving category C driving licence (HGV 2). Ideally you’ll hold the CE (HGV 1) licence too, although this isn’t essential as we can help you with this. Alongside this, you’ll need a Driver CPC (certificate of professional competence) qualification, and a digital drivers/tachograph card. To be comfortable adapting to new technology - training will be provided. To be happy working shifts, which include evenings, nights, weekends and Bank Holidays.
